Big news in our house this week! Β Ken accepted a new job and put in his two-weeks notice at his current job. Β The new job is literally a 4 minute drive from our house, which will be a welcome change considering his current one hour (each way) commute. Β The new job is lower pay, but 1) he will be saving $3000 on metro commuting costs alone, and 2) he will be reclaiming 10 full hours per week thanks to the near zero commuting time. Β So the minor paycut was well worth it.
